Inflammation Explained: Its Role and Health Consequences

Inflammation is the body’s natural defense mechanism against ‌injury and infection, designed to promote healing. However, when inflammation becomes chronic, it ‍can lead to serious health issues including diabetes, heart disease, ​and autoimmune conditions. Recognizing the impact of ongoing inflammation underscores the importance of dietary choices in managing and ⁣possibly reversing these harmful effects.

How Nutrition Influences Inflammatory Processes

Scientific research consistently ‌shows that ​diet plays a crucial role in modulating inflammation.‌ The typical Western diet, rich in refined sugars and processed foods, tends to exacerbate inflammatory responses.Conversely, diets emphasizing whole, nutrient-dense ‍foods, healthy fats, and quality proteins have demonstrated significant anti-inflammatory benefits.The‌ LCHF diet is notably effective because it shifts the⁣ body’s energy source ⁣from carbohydrates to fats.​ This metabolic switch helps regulate blood glucose levels and enhances metabolic health,both of which are critical in reducing inflammation.

Understanding the Low Carb High Fat (LCHF) Approach

The LCHF diet focuses on drastically reducing⁣ carbohydrate ‌intake‌ while increasing healthy​ fat consumption. This approach⁤ shifts the body’s primary energy source from glucose (derived‍ from​ carbs) to ketones ​(derived from fat). This metabolic shift helps reduce inflammatory markers‌ in the​ body, supporting overall well-being.

How LCHF Reduces​ Inflammation

  • Stable Blood Sugar: Lower carb intake prevents spikes ‍in blood sugar and insulin, which are major drivers of⁣ inflammation.
  • Improved Mitochondrial Function: Fat metabolism enhances mitochondrial efficiency, producing fewer inflammatory oxidative byproducts.
  • Beneficial‍ Fatty ⁤Acids: Consuming ‍omega-3 ‌and monounsaturated fats helps actively reduce ‍inflammatory processes.
  • Reduced Processed ⁤Foods: LCHF‌ naturally eliminates⁣ most ⁤processed⁣ sugars and refined carbs, ​known triggers ⁢of ‌inflammation.

Foods to Avoid on a Low Carb ⁢High Fat Anti-Inflammation Plan

Eliminating ‌pro-inflammatory foods ​supports the effectiveness of your LCHF diet:

  • Sugary snacks and desserts
  • Refined ⁤grains and white bread
  • Processed vegetable oils (corn, soybean, canola oils)
  • Trans fats found⁣ in many packaged ⁢and fast foods
  • Excessive ⁢alcohol intake
  • Highly processed meats ⁣with additives

Challenges and Tips for Transitioning⁤ to LCHF

While the LCHF diet offers many benefits, some may experience transitional symptoms such as fatigue, dizziness, or headaches—commonly known as the “keto flu.” To⁤ mitigate these effects, it’s advisable to gradually⁢ reduce carbohydrate intake and maintain adequate hydration and electrolyte balance. consulting with a healthcare provider before starting this diet is especially important for individuals with⁤ pre-existing medical conditions.
